开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> 深入解析java编译器 pdf_Java编译器:基于《深入解析》PDF
默认会员免费送
帮助中心 >

深入解析java编译器 pdf_Java编译器:基于《深入解析》PDF

2024-12-25 22:35:38
深入解析java编译器 pdf_java编译器:基于《深入解析》pdf
《深入解析java编译器》

java编译器在java开发中起着至关重要的作用。它将java源文件转换为字节码,这一过程涉及多个复杂的步骤。

从词法分析开始,编译器把源文件的字符流分解成一个个单词。接着进行语法分析,构建出代表程序结构的抽象语法树。语义分析会检查程序的语义正确性,例如类型匹配等。

深入解析java编译器的pdf能帮助开发者更好地理解编译原理。这有助于优化代码编写,例如明白哪些代码结构在编译时更高效。对于理解java运行机制、解决编译时的疑难问题也有着极大的意义。它是深入掌握java技术的一个重要窗口,无论是初学者还是资深开发者都能从中获取宝贵的知识财富。

java编译器在线

java编译器在线
java编译器在线:便捷的编程工具》

java编译器在线为程序员提供了极大的便利。它无需在本地安装复杂的开发环境,只要有网络连接就能使用。

在线java编译器界面简洁直观,用户可以轻松输入java代码。在输入代码后,能迅速进行编译,若代码存在语法错误,编译器会准确指出错误位置并给出提示信息,方便开发者快速修正。这对于初学者而言,是学习java编程的好帮手,可以快速验证代码的正确性。对于有经验的开发者,在临时需要编译小段代码或者快速测试某个算法时,在线编译器也是一个高效的选择。总之,java编译器在线让java编程变得更加灵活、高效且易于上手。

java编译器使用方法

java编译器使用方法
java编译器使用方法

java编译器用于将java源程序(.java文件)编译成字节码文件(.class文件)。

首先,确保安装了java开发工具包(jdk),其中包含编译器(javac)。在命令行中,进入java源文件所在的目录。例如,若有一个名为helloworld.java的源文件。输入“javac helloworld.java”,如果源文件没有语法错误,就会在同一目录下生成helloworld.class文件。

需要注意的是,源文件中的类名要与文件名一致。如果有包(package)声明,还需要按照包结构创建相应的文件夹层级。正确使用java编译器是java开发的第一步,它为后续的程序运行和部署奠定了基础。

深入解析java编译器源码剖析与实例详解pdf百度云

深入解析java编译器源码剖析与实例详解pdf百度云
《java编译器源码剖析与实例详解pdf百度云资源:深入探索java编译的奥秘》

java编译器在java开发中起着至关重要的作用。理解其源码能让开发者深入java语言底层机制。然而,寻找《java编译器源码剖析与实例详解》pdf资源的百度云链接需要谨慎。

一方面,通过正规渠道获取书籍资源是尊重知识版权的体现。如果是为了深入学习java编译器源码,可以尝试从图书馆借阅实体书或购买电子书。另一方面,虽然百度云可能存在一些用户分享的资源,但很多可能涉及侵权行为。在学习java编译器的过程中,合法且可靠的途径有助于构建扎实的知识体系,同时也能促进技术社区的健康发展。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信